Output 517475a5a3527c81e9f50e50300c60d4c83cdbbe8d2c38c78bbd43f99fc2453e:3

value
1956000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ebe8cf84d81e600fa7960d7acb45a5e32fa23b OP_EQUAL
address
3KjXecDSQfghFynknJfQi7uLY6ZhErWqKA
transaction
517475a5a3527c81e9f50e50300c60d4c83cdbbe8d2c38c78bbd43f99fc2453e
spent
true